I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++ Discussion :

Lancer un exe sans Microsoft Visual Studio


Sujet :

C++

  1. #1
    Membre du Club
    Femme Profil pro
    Étudiant
    Inscrit en
    Mai 2015
    Messages
    52
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2015
    Messages : 52
    Points : 47
    Points
    47
    Par défaut Lancer un exe sans Microsoft Visual Studio
    Bonjour je suis débutante en c++ et j'essaie actuellement d'éxécuter une application codé en C++/Qt sans Microsoft Visual Studio.

    Je vous explique actuellement dans Microsoft Visual Studio j'ai un projet qui est défini en tant que "Startup project". Pour lancer mon application, je clique sur l'icône du triangle vert "Local Windows Debugger" de Microsoft Visual Studio et mon application c++/Qt est ainsi lancé.

    Moi je voudrais lancer mon application sans passer par Visual Studio, en écrivant quelque chose par exemple dans un fichier txt. Et lancer ce fichier txt via le terminal de commande Windows.

    Mais je ne sais pas quoi écrire dans le fichier txt, ni comment le lancer via le terminal de commande Windows.

    J'ai déjà essayé de taper dans mon terminal windows : cl /EHsc monapplication.cpp
    mais un message d'erreur m'indique que : impossible de démarrer le programme car il manque Qt5Cored.dll sur votre ordinateur.
    Pourtant lorsque je lance l'application avec Visual Studio tout va bien.

    Merci pour vos précieuses aides.

  2. #2
    Membre confirmé

    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Mars 2015
    Messages
    294
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Mars 2015
    Messages : 294
    Points : 558
    Points
    558
    Par défaut
    Bonjour,
    dans le repertoire \bin de ta version de Qt tu as normalement l'utilitaire windeployqt qui te permet de deployer une application Qt sous windows(il faut en fait mettre toutes les dll de Qt et d'autres dans le repertoire de ton executable ce que fait normalement windeployqt)

  3. #3
    Membre du Club
    Femme Profil pro
    Étudiant
    Inscrit en
    Mai 2015
    Messages
    52
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mai 2015
    Messages : 52
    Points : 47
    Points
    47
    Par défaut
    Effectivement il fallait coller tous les fichiers dll dans le répertoire de l'application. Merci beaucoup!

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Presentation de Microsoft Visual Studio.Net
    Par saredo dans le forum MFC
    Réponses: 4
    Dernier message: 26/06/2006, 09h03
  2. Microsoft Visual Studio C++
    Par benjiprog dans le forum MFC
    Réponses: 3
    Dernier message: 15/02/2006, 11h35
  3. Réponses: 1
    Dernier message: 16/01/2006, 20h15
  4. Microsoft Visual Studio 6.0 ????
    Par zalett dans le forum VB 6 et antérieur
    Réponses: 6
    Dernier message: 08/12/2005, 17h17
  5. [VB] lacement d'un projet.exe sans avoir Visual Basi
    Par acrenn dans le forum VB 6 et antérieur
    Réponses: 6
    Dernier message: 10/08/2005, 16h25

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o